Output dab8ea90f1e32c14e9131bb8a63a52a31bd9e06b06959b4f3dca6581fd94d8f7:5

value
5160809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cc60ab176a5ec036886feefedcbef366234b9e8 OP_EQUAL
address
3QjZT4vYZSH5Syo1oMLRgzerMUarvRye7F
transaction
dab8ea90f1e32c14e9131bb8a63a52a31bd9e06b06959b4f3dca6581fd94d8f7
spent
true